Peer reviewedHardy, Charles – New England Journal of History, 1992
Describes the use of Charles Minard's graphic of Napoleon's 1812 Russian Campaign as an instructional tool in history classes. Maintains that the graphic, created in 1861, can be analyzed by students to determine six historical and geographical factors involved in Napoleon's defeat. Includes a copy of Minard's graphic. (CFR)

Hopkins, Brian – PRIMUS, 2004
The interconnected world of actors and movies is a familiar, rich example for graph theory. This paper gives the history of the "Kevin Bacon Game" and makes extensive use of a Web site to analyze the underlying graph.
